Adroit Cadet@Adroit_Cadet·
Casemiro is doing great as leggy B2B destroyer, but his passing quality is really poor. His switches are often overhit, he makes dangerous decisions relative to the quality of his executions which can lead to dangerous turnovers. But he’s doing a good job at driving the team and providing big moments. Mainoo is a dribbler interior type who doesn’t really impact games via passing. So he needs to be with pass-first players. He can also lack intensity at times (though I liked the manner of how he got about the pitch vs Bournemouth; was a proper 8 performance for most part)
